SecurityBindingElement.SecurityHeaderLayout Свойство

Определение

Возвращает или задает порядок элементов в заголовке безопасности для данной привязки.

public:
 property System::ServiceModel::Channels::SecurityHeaderLayout SecurityHeaderLayout { System::ServiceModel::Channels::SecurityHeaderLayout get(); void set(System::ServiceModel::Channels::SecurityHeaderLayout value); };
public System.ServiceModel.Channels.SecurityHeaderLayout SecurityHeaderLayout { get; set; }
member this.SecurityHeaderLayout : System.ServiceModel.Channels.SecurityHeaderLayout with get, set
Public Property SecurityHeaderLayout As SecurityHeaderLayout

Значение свойства

SecurityHeaderLayout, представляющий порядок элементов в заголовке безопасности для данной привязки. Значение по умолчанию — Strict.

Исключения

Значение не является допустимым значением SecurityHeaderLayout.

Комментарии

Перечисление SecurityHeaderLayout содержит следующие члены:

  • Strict: элементы добавляются в заголовок безопасности в соответствии с общим принципом "объявить перед использованием".

  • Lax: элементы добавляются в заголовок безопасности в любом порядке, отвечающем требованиям к безопасности сообщений WSS: SOAP Message Security.

  • LaxTimestampFirst: элементы добавляются в заголовок безопасности в любом порядке, отвечающем требованиям к безопасности сообщений WSS: SOAP, за исключением того, что первым элементом в заголовке безопасности должен быть элемент wsse:Timestamp.

  • LaxTimestampLast: элементы добавляются в заголовок безопасности в любом порядке, отвечающем требованиям к безопасности сообщений WSS: SOAP, за исключением того, что последним элементом в заголовке безопасности должен быть элемент wsse:Timestamp.

Применяется к